Buying Guide: Dry-Film Lubricants for Locks

What should I look for in a lock lubricant?

Key factors include dry-film or grease-free formulas, temperature tolerance, compatibility with metals and plastics, and whether the product leaves residue. For electronic components, dielectric safety is essential. For seasonal use, graphite-based products help prevent freezing, while PTFE-based formulas reduce friction for smooth operation over time.

When is a dry-film lubricant preferable?

Dry-film lubricants, such as Teflon/PTFE coatings, are ideal for long-lasting protection in high-use or outdoor locks. They minimize sludge and buildup while maintaining low friction. In contrast, oil-based lubes may attract dust and require more frequent cleaning.

How do I apply lock lubricants correctly?

Use the precision straw for narrow keyways or a broader spray for whole lock bodies. Wipe away excess, and avoid over-lubricating. Allow a few minutes for the film to set before use. For electronic components, choose dielectric-safe products and avoid liquids near sensitive circuitry.

Are graphite-based products safe for all locks?

Graphite-based formulations are effective in cold temperatures and do not attract water. However, graphite can stain certain materials and may be messy to apply in visible areas. It’s best used where it won’t contact painted surfaces or plastics that show staining.

FAQ

  1. Is a dry-film lubricant better than an oil-based one for locks?
    Yes, dry-film lubricants generally leave less residue and resist attracting dirt, making them suitable for long-term maintenance of locks, hinges, and mechanisms.
  2. Can I use lock lubricant on automotive locks?
    Yes, most of the listed products are suitable for home and automotive locks, but follow the product’s specifications regarding metal and plastic compatibility.
  3. Will these products prevent locks from freezing?
    Graphite-based lubricants help in cold weather by reducing moisture-related sticking, while dry films like Teflon coatings provide robust protection across temperatures.
  4. Do I need to avoid any surfaces when applying these lubricants?
    Some products may damage clear polycarbonate or polystyrene; always check surface compatibility and apply carefully to avoid overspray on sensitive plastics.
  5. How often should I reapply?
    Reapplication frequency depends on usage, environment, and the lubricant type. High-traffic or outdoor locks may require more frequent maintenance than indoor, light-use hardware.
  6. Can I use multiple lubricants in a single lock?
    It’s generally best to choose one lubricant suited to your lock type and application. Mixing products can lead to inconsistent performance or residue buildup.
